(WNY News Now) – An officer-involved shooting incident occurred on Tuesday, September 5, 2023, when a barricaded suspect fired upon Millcreek officers responding to a call for an unwanted guest. The suspect now faces a slew of serious charges.

Millcreek, PA – On September 5, 2023, at 3:06 PM, Millcreek Police Department received a call regarding an unwanted guest at 1045 East Gore Rd. The caller, who retreated to a safe location, alerted law enforcement. Two Millcreek officers arrived at 3:20 PM, soon requesting backup due to a barricaded male inside and a house fire.

As the suspect, Keegan Gabriel Baker, a 26-year-old from Erie, appeared in the front entrance and fired at officers, they returned fire, injuring him. Baker was transported to Hamot for medical attention. No officers or bystanders were harmed.

Charges have been filed against Baker, including Attempted Criminal Homicide, Aggravated Assault, Arson, Burglary, and Criminal Mischief. He will be arraigned pending medical treatment. The officers’ identities remain undisclosed as the investigation continues.
